A Journey of Growth and Collaboration

What began as LOXIM’s polymers division evolved through years of research, technical partnerships, and customer-centric innovation. Key milestones include:

2006

Expansion into Engineering Plastics with a state-of-the-art facility in Sanand

2010 onwards

National distribution partnerships for polymer resins and compounds

2011

Strategic partnership with ALBIS Plastic, Germany for distribution in India

2023

Installed a polymer recycling machine at our plant, enabling in-house recycling and reuse of plastic materials, and reinforcing our commitment to resource efficiency and responsible production.

2025

Established LATI-LOXIM Thermoplastics Pvt. Ltd.—a joint venture between LATI S.p.A., Italy and LOXIM’s Engineering Plastics division, strengthening our global footprint in high-performance thermoplastics.
